gpt4 book ai didi

c++ - 使 MFC CTabCtrl 不使用绘图选项卡的完整控件宽度

转载 作者:行者123 更新时间:2023-11-28 03:28:59 25 4
gpt4 key购买 nike

我们有一个有点复杂的请求,要求在我们的应用程序中进行更改,即让我们的选项卡控件之一只能访问控件的部分宽度以绘制选项卡,这样我们就可以粘贴一些侧面剩余区域中的附加状态文本。

图片可能会有所帮助:

Complex UI Request

如您所见,选项卡控件一直延伸到对话框的右侧,但我们希望为“总库存成本”保留一个区域,并且我们希望确保其他选项卡(常见的)不会不要侵占那个区域。

除了完全重写应用程序之外,我愿意接受几乎所有实现它的方法。如果有更好的选项卡控件,我们可以切换选项卡控件,或者在合理范围内更改选项卡设置的实现。

本来以为可以分别设置客户区和标签绘制矩形区,但是好像不是这样。如果我错了,请纠正我。

感谢任何帮助!

最佳答案

如果我没理解错的话,你得到的是这个

主窗口的客户区:

  • -> tab ctrl 占据整个区域
  • -> 选项卡控件之上的一些其他控件

你可以做的是这个

主窗口的客户区:

  • -> 底部的小选项卡控件
  • -> 主窗口客户区的所有其他控件

关于c++ - 使 MFC CTabCtrl 不使用绘图选项卡的完整控件宽度,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13126085/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com